You have a pile of MongoDB data and a room full of people asking for dashboards. That’s when MongoDB Redash earns its keep. It turns the chaos of raw collections into something managers can trust without demanding another custom app each week.

MongoDB stores documents, flexible and JSON-shaped. Redash queries data, hands back visualizations, and wraps them in permissions teams can review. Together they solve a familiar problem: fast data-driven answers without exposing credentials or staging dumps. With MongoDB as your transactional core and Redash as your window to it, you get repeatable, queryable truth.

Connecting MongoDB and Redash starts with a read-only user. Redash speaks to the database through its query runner and stores results for caching. The real win comes when you route that connection through an identity-aware proxy or a private network tunnel. That keeps temporary credentials contained while allowing Redash to refresh dashboards automatically. Permissions in MongoDB align with workspace roles in Redash, so analysts see what they should and not a byte more.

Once dashboards scale across departments, small details matter. Narrow your projections to reduce payload size. Enforce RBAC at the collection level. Rotate service user passwords or switch to ephemeral credentials through tools that integrate with your identity provider, whether that’s Okta, Google Workspace, or AWS IAM. Good hygiene turns dashboard automation from fragile scripts into stable infrastructure.

How do I connect MongoDB to Redash?
Add a new data source in Redash, select MongoDB, then provide the host URL, read-only credentials, and authentication details. Test the connection, save, and you are ready to query collections and create visual dashboards from live MongoDB documents.
